Broun, Elizabeth (Foreword), Walter Hopps, Andy Grundberg, and Howard N. Fox (Essays). William Christenberry (New York; Washington, D.C.: Aperture; Smithsonian American Art Museum, 2006).
English, First Edition, a Near Fine book in a Near Fine dust jacket, HC, 4to, 10 1/2" x 12 3/4," 203 pp., including illustrations.
ISBN: 1931788898

SIGNED. Near Fine orange-red cloth-covered boards. Covers have slight bumping to head and tail of spine, else pristine and intact, binding tight, sharp tips. Near Fine white paper dust jacket with black lettering on spine. Dust jacket has bumping along top edge and tips, else clean and intact. Replete with printed photographs and illustrations in black-and-white and color. SIGNED by the artist on half-title in black ink: "To Jackie, With pleasure & affection, Bill C., June 2006." Beautiful catalogue featuring the art of William Christenberry (1936-2016), an American photographer, sculptor, painter, and mixed-media artist from Hale County, Alabama. Christenberry is perhaps best-known for his photos of the American South capturing scenes of seemingly uninhabited landscapes and derelict buildings and monuments. Principally illustrations of his photos with brief captions. Also illustrated are a few of his mixed-media sculptures.
